Title: Kazutaka Yoshizawa: Innovator in Semiconductor Technology

Introduction

Kazutaka Yoshizawa is a prominent inventor based in Kawasaki, Japan. He has made significant contributions to the field of semiconductor technology, holding a total of 6 patents. His work focuses on enhancing the performance and reliability of semiconductor devices.

Latest Patents

Yoshizawa's latest patents include innovative methods for manufacturing semiconductor devices. One notable patent is for a semiconductor device having a guard ring and its manufacturing method. This invention involves etching an interlayer insulation film to form contact holes in an integrated circuit part without forming a trench in the guard ring part. The process includes ion implantation in source/drain regions and high-temperature annealing to activate implanted impurities. Another significant patent is for a semiconductor device that includes titanium wires and its manufacturing method. This invention ensures that insulation defects are minimized, even with increased integration levels.
